PureFtpd 连接数据库错误

简介:

用Ubuntu一段时间了,作为服务器真是好用,还轻快的很。

作为服务器怎么能没有ftp呢,这里用了pureftpd,没有用vsftpd是因为听大牛说听麻烦,没用过没发言权,不过pureftpd真的挺好用,php客户端管理方便的很,用户数据都在mysql里,功能也很全面。

今天上ftp发现链接不上,总是出现下面的错误:

Command:    PASS *******
Response:    530 Login authentication failed
Error:    Critical error
Error:    Could not connect to server

一开是以为密码错了,重置了简单的密码,还是不对,上ftp管理的网站发现操作又是正常的,说明密码是对的,又以为是编码问题,因为我的locale总有警告,改好了还是不对于是cat下/var/log/pure-ftpd/ tranfer.log记录都是空的。奇怪了。。。。

于是想是不是sql查询的问题,开启profiling查了下根本没记录,难道是链接数据库有问题,想起来前面修改过一次root密码,现在不能用127.0.0.1链接了,于是修改/etc/pure-ftpd/db/mysql.conf中的地址为localhost,至此修复。




本文转自today4king博客园博客,原文链接:http://www.cnblogs.com/jinzhao/p/3428420.html,如需转载请自行联系原作者

目录
打赏
0
0
0
0
49
分享
相关文章
【YashanDB知识库】原生mysql驱动配置连接崖山数据库
【YashanDB知识库】原生mysql驱动配置连接崖山数据库
【YashanDB知识库】原生mysql驱动配置连接崖山数据库
YashanDB数据库服务端SSL连接配置
YashanDB支持通过SSL连接确保数据传输安全,需在服务端生成根证书、服务器证书及DH文件,并将根证书提供给客户端以完成身份验证。服务端配置包括使用OpenSSL工具生成证书、设置SSL参数并重启数据库;客户端则需下载根证书并正确配置环境变量与`yasc_env.ini`文件。注意:启用SSL后,所有客户端必须持有根证书才能连接,且SSL与密码认证独立运行。
【Oracle】使用Navicat Premium连接Oracle数据库两种方法
以上就是两种使用Navicat Premium连接Oracle数据库的方法介绍,希望对你有所帮助!
215 28
在C++的QT框架中实现SQLite数据库的连接与操作
以上就是在C++的QT框架中实现SQLite数据库的连接与操作的基本步骤。这些步骤包括创建数据库连接、执行SQL命令、处理查询结果和关闭数据库连接。在实际使用中,你可能需要根据具体的需求来修改这些代码。
121 14
【YashanDB知识库】YDC连接数据库报错yasdb return code is zero
【YashanDB知识库】YDC连接数据库报错yasdb return code is zero
如何排查和解决PHP连接数据库MYSQL失败写锁的问题
通过本文的介绍,您可以系统地了解如何排查和解决PHP连接MySQL数据库失败及写锁问题。通过检查配置、确保服务启动、调整防火墙设置和用户权限,以及识别和解决长时间运行的事务和死锁问题,可以有效地保障应用的稳定运行。
196 25
Unity连接Mysql数据库 增 删 改 查
在 Unity 中连接 MySQL 数据库,需使用 MySQL Connector/NET 作为数据库连接驱动,通过提供服务器地址、端口、用户名和密码等信息建立 TCP/IP 连接。代码示例展示了如何创建连接对象并执行增删改查操作,确保数据交互的实现。测试代码中,通过 `MySqlConnection` 类连接数据库,并使用 `MySqlCommand` 执行 SQL 语句,实现数据的查询、插入、删除和更新功能。

热门文章

最新文章

A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等